The flooring installer market in and around Coeymans, NY, is characteristic of a small town situated within a larger metropolitan region. While there are a handful of local contractors (like those based in adjacent Ravena), residents often rely on established companies from the broader Capital District (Albany, Schenectady, Troy) that service a wide area. The competition is moderate, with quality varying significantly. Reputable providers are in high demand and often have waiting lists. Typical pricing is competitive with upstate New York averages, with project costs heavily dependent on material choice. For standard laminate/LVP installation, homeowners can expect prices ranging from $3-$7 per square foot for labor, while high-end hardwood or complex tile work can exceed $8-$12+ per square foot. The most successful contractors distinguish themselves through strong warranties, proper licensing and insurance, and a portfolio of completed projects.

Coeymans experiences all four seasons with cold, damp winters and warm, humid summers. This significant humidity fluctuation means materials like solid hardwood can expand and contract, potentially causing gaps or buckling. We often recommend engineered hardwood, luxury vinyl plank (LVP), or tile for better dimensional stability, and always stress the importance of proper acclimation of materials in your home for several days before installation.
Installation labor costs in the Capital Region, including Coeymans, typically range from $2 to $8 per square foot, heavily dependent on the material and job complexity. For example, basic carpet or laminate installation starts on the lower end, while intricate tile patterns or high-end hardwood are at the premium end. The total project cost will include material, underlayment, removal/disposal of old flooring, and any necessary subfloor preparation, which is common in older local homes.
For standard residential flooring replacement, a permit is usually not required in the Town of Coeymans. However, if the installation is part of a larger renovation that alters the home's structure (like leveling a subfloor) or is for a commercial property, you should check with the Coeymans Building Department. A key local regulation is that all contractors must be licensed and insured in New York State, which you should always verify for your protection.
Late spring through early fall is generally ideal, as temperatures are more consistent and humidity levels are easier to control for material acclimation. Winter installations are possible but require extra planning; your home's heating system must be running consistently for days prior to bring the space to a normal living temperature, and delivered materials must be protected from cold and moisture during transport.
Seek local providers with strong community reputations, verified NYS licensing, and insurance. Ask for references from recent jobs in Coeymans or nearby towns like Ravena. Key questions include: "How do you handle subfloor issues common in our older homes?", "What is your process for acclimating flooring to our local climate?", and "Does your quote include all preparation, disposal, and a detailed timeline?" A trustworthy installer will provide clear, detailed answers.
